The isolate_litellm_state conftest fixture saved/restored litellm.callbacks but never cleared it before each test, unlike the other callback lists. It also didn't handle litellm.model_fallbacks. Leaked callbacks and fallback config caused mocked tests to route through Router/fallback paths, hitting real APIs with mock keys.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>

"""
|
|
Test that metadata is passed to custom callbacks during chat completion calls to codex models.
|
|
|
|
Fixes issue: Metadata is no longer passed to custom callback during chat completion
|
|
calls to codex models (#21204)
|
|
|
|
Codex models (gpt-5.1-codex, gpt-5.2-codex) use mode=responses and route through
|
|
responses_api_bridge. The bridge converts metadata to litellm_metadata. This test
|
|
verifies metadata is preserved for custom callbacks via kwargs['litellm_params']['metadata'].
|
|
"""
